Step 1: Add the 5 cloves of garlic, 10 chillies, and 2 tbsp of coriander to a food processor and blend for about 1 minute until broken down.
Step 3
Step 2: Now add the 3/4 teaspoon of salt, 1 tbsp of oyster sauce, 2 tbsp of fish sauce, 1/2 cup of lime juice, and 3 tbsp of sugar to the food processor and blend for a final 20 seconds.
Step 4
Step 3: Serve with your chosen seafood dish and enjoy! Goes particularly well with grilled seafood.
